Installing a tape drive
To install the tape drive, complete the following steps:
__ 1. If your new tape drive has a bezel attached, remove the bezel before you
install the tape drive in the autoloader:
To remove the bezel:
a. Using a small flat-blade screwdriver, push the bezel side catch tabs on
each side of the tape drive inward until they clear the metal tabs
attached to the tape drive chassis.
b. With the bezel side catch tabs clear of the metal tabs that are on the tape
drive chassis, rotate the bottom of the bezel out and up from the front of
the drive.
c. Disengage the upper tabs from the top of the tape drive chassis and lift
the bezel up and away from the drive.
__ 2. Place the tape drive right side up (check the labels on the tape drive). Place
the brackets you removed from the original tape drive on the new tape
drive and attach them, using the two screws for each bracket.
__ 3. With the tape drive right side up, slide the tape drive into the autoloader
until the bracket flanges rest against the flanges on the autoloader back
panel.
__ 4. Connect the serial cable to the tape drive. The connector is keyed to ensure
the correct orientation.
Note: Before you connect the SCSI cable in the following step, make sure that
none of the pins on the SCSI cable are bent.
__ 5. Connect the SCSI cable and power cable. The connectors are keyed to ensure
the correct orientation.
__ 6. Route the cables into the notch in each bracket, and make sure that the
cables do not hang below the tape drive. Make sure that the serial cable is
not pinched between the SCSI cable and the side of the notch.
